Measurement of integrated luminosity and center-of-mass energy of data taken by BESⅢ at s~(1/2)=2.125 GeV

To study the nature of the state Y(2175),a dedicated data set of e~ + e~-collision data was collected at the center-of-mass energy of 2.125 GeV with the BESⅢ detector at the BEPCⅡ collider.By analyzing large-angle Bhabha scattering events,the integrated luminosity of this data set is determined to be 108.49±0.02±0.85 pb~(-1),where the first uncertainty is statistical and the second one is systematic.In addition,the center-of-mass energy of the data set is determined with radiative dimuon events to be 2126.55±0.03±0.85 MeV,where the first uncertainty is statistical and the second one is systematic.
